ホームページ >ウェブフロントエンド >フロントエンドQ&A >float にはどのような性質がありますか?
float 属性には、left、right、none、inherit などが含まれます。詳細な導入: 1. left、要素を左にフローティングにします。要素がフロートに設定されている場合、要素は通常のドキュメント フローから切り離され、親要素または別のフローティング要素の端に遭遇するまで左に移動します。 ; 2. right, 要素を右にフロートさせます。要素をフロートに設定すると、通常のドキュメント フローから切り離され、親要素の端または別のフローティング要素に遭遇するまで右に移動します。3 none、デフォルト値、要素は浮動せず、そのままの状態で待機します。
このチュートリアルのオペレーティング システム: Windows 10 システム、DELL G3 コンピューター。
float 属性は、CSS で要素のフローティングを制御するために使用される属性で、次の属性値があります:
1. left: 要素を左にフローティングします。要素がフロートに設定されている場合、要素は通常のドキュメント フローから抜け出し、親要素の端または別のフローティング要素に遭遇するまで左に移動します。
2. right: 要素を右にフローティングします。要素がフローティングに設定されている場合、要素は通常のドキュメント フローから切り離され、親要素の端または別のフローティング要素に遭遇するまで右に移動します。
3. なし: デフォルト値。要素は浮くことはなく、所定の位置に留まります。この値は、以前のフローティング設定をキャンセルするために使用されます。
4. 継承: 要素は、親要素の浮動属性を継承します。この値により、要素は親要素の float プロパティに基づいてレイアウトされます。
上記の属性値に加えて、float 属性には次の属性も含まれます:
1. float-width: float の幅を定義します。このプロパティでは、フロートの最大幅と最小幅、および幅が調整可能かどうかを設定できます。
2. float-height: フローティングの高さを定義します。このプロパティでは、フロートの最大高さと最小高さ、および高さが調整可能かどうかを設定できます。
3. float-clear: 浮動要素の後に何をクリアするかを定義します。このプロパティは、フロート要素がクリアされる方向 (左、右、上など) を設定します。
4. float-display: 親要素の背景と枠線をフローティング子要素に表示するかどうかを定義します。このプロパティは、背景と境界線を表示するかどうかを設定できます。
5. float-offset: 浮動オフセットを定義します。このプロパティは、親要素を基準とした浮動要素の位置オフセットを設定します。
float-fallback: 特定の状況でフォールバック float レイアウトを使用するかどうかを定義します。このプロパティは、フォールバック フローティング レイアウトを有効にするかどうかを設定できます。
これらのプロパティは、実際の開発で必要に応じて選択して使用できる、より詳細な制御オプションを提供します。 float 属性は一般的に使用されるレイアウト制御方法ですが、現代のフロントエンド開発では、CSS フレックスボックスやグリッド レイアウトなど、他の多くのより強力で柔軟なレイアウト制御方法も登場していることに注意してください。これらの新しいメソッドは、現代の Web デザインのニーズをより適切に満たすための、より多くのレイアウト制御オプションを提供します。
以上がfloat にはどのような性質がありますか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。